The simple idea (no memorising)
Don't memorise thirty syndromes. Ask, in order:
- Are breasts present? → tells you if estrogen has been working.
- Is the uterus present? → tells you if the Müllerian ducts developed.
- Then add FSH to locate the level of any failure.
The signature diagnoses
- Imperforate hymen — everything works, but the exit is sealed. Periods happen but can't escape, causing monthly pain and a bulging bluish membrane. (The blood pools in the vagina — haematocolpos.) A small surgical opening cures it.
- MRKH — 46,XX, working ovaries (so normal breasts), but no womb (Müllerian failure). Normal pubic hair.
- Androgen insensitivity (CAIS) — 46,XY, testes present (so no womb, because AMH removed it), a female appearance and breasts, but sparse pubic hair (the body can't "hear" androgens).
- Turner syndrome — 45,X, streak ovaries → high FSH, short stature, poor breast development.
- Kallmann — the brain never sends GnRH → low FSH + a lost sense of smell.
The two neat contrasts
- MRKH vs CAIS: both have breasts and no uterus. The tell: MRKH = normal pubic hair (46,XX); CAIS = sparse pubic hair (46,XY).
- Turner vs Kallmann: both have low estrogen. The tell: Turner = FSH high (ovary failed); Kallmann = FSH low (brain silent) + anosmia.
